Head stor2a
NIC0 - stor2a (dedicated hostname, locked IP)
NIC2 - stor2 (service hostname/IP, fail-over so clients use this for NFS mount, in case of active-passive cluster)

Head stor2b
NIC1 - stor2b (dedicated hostname, locked IP)
NIC2 - stor2 (service hostname/IP, fail-over so clients use this for NFS mount, in case of active-passive cluster)
